NettetMol% and % by volume should be the same, assuming ideal gas behavior. For example, a sample containing 11.2 liters (1/2 mole) of hydrogen and 11.2 liters (1/2 mole) of methane should be 50 mol% hydrogen and 50 mol% methane, as well as 50% hydrogen by volume and 50% methane by volume. Nettet5. mar. 2014 · Using the Ideal Gas Law, you would find the volume of 1 mole of a gas at Standard Temperature and Pressure (STP).. STP = 1 atm of pressure and 273 K for temperature. P = 1 atm V = ??? n = 1 mole R = 0.0821 atm L/mol K K = 273 K. #P V = n R T # solves to #V = (n R T) / P#

Nettet22. nov. 2011 · To do this, we need the balanced equation to start: Mg (S) + 2HCl --> MgCl 2 + H 2 (G) In order to get the moles of hydrogen gas, we can calculate the moles of magnesium, and then using the mole ratio from the equation, get the moles for hydrogen. So: 0.132 g / 24.31 mm = 0.00542 mol of Mg.

Nettet25. aug. 2024 · In other words, 1 mole of a gas will occupy 22.4 L at STP, assuming ideal gas behavior. At STP, the volume of a gas is only dependent on number of moles of that gas and is independent of molar mass. With this information we can calculate the density (\( \rho \)) of a gas using only its molar mass. NettetThe molar volume of an ideal gas at 100 kPa (1 bar) is 0.022 710 954 641 485... m 3 /mol at 0 °C, 0.024 789 570 296 023... m 3 /mol at 25 °C. The molar volume of an ideal gas at 1 atmosphere of pressure is 0.022 413 969 545 014... m 3 /mol at 0 °C, 0.024 465 403 697 038... m 3 /mol at 25 °C. Crystalline solids
